Subject: [PATCH v2] perf: Fix build break on powerpc due to sample_reg_masks
perf_regs.c does not get built on Powerpc as CONFIG_PERF_REGS is false.
So the weak definition for 'sample_regs_masks' doesn't get picked up.
Adding perf_regs.o to util/Build unconditionally, exposes a redefinition
error for 'perf_reg_value()' function (due to the static inline version
in util/perf_regs.h). So use #ifdef HAVE_PERF_REGS_SUPPORT' around that
function.

Changelog[v2]
- [Jiri Olsa] include <linux/compiler.h> for __maybe_unused
---
tools/perf/util/Build | 2 +-
tools/perf/util/perf_regs.c | 2 ++
tools/perf/util/perf_regs.h | 1 +
3 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/tools/perf/util/Build b/tools/perf/util/Build
index 4bc7a9a..9217119 100644
--- a/tools/perf/util/Build
+++ b/tools/perf/util/Build
@@ -18,6 +18,7 @@ libperf-y += levenshtein.o
libperf-y += llvm-utils.o
libperf-y += parse-options.o
libperf-y += parse-events.o
+libperf-y += perf_regs.o
libperf-y += path.o
libperf-y += rbtree.o
libperf-y += bitmap.o
@@ -104,7 +105,6 @@ libperf-$(CONFIG_LIBBABELTRACE) += data-convert-bt.o
libperf-y += scripting-engines/
-libperf-$(CONFIG_PERF_REGS) += perf_regs.o
libperf-$(CONFIG_ZLIB) += zlib.o
libperf-$(CONFIG_LZMA) += lzma.o
diff --git a/tools/perf/util/perf_regs.c b/tools/perf/util/perf_regs.c
index 885e8ac..6b8eb13 100644
--- a/tools/perf/util/perf_regs.c
+++ b/tools/perf/util/perf_regs.c
@@ -6,6 +6,7 @@ const struct sample_reg __weak sample_reg_masks[] = {
SMPL_REG_END
};
+#ifdef HAVE_PERF_REGS_SUPPORT
int perf_reg_value(u64 *valp, struct regs_dump *regs, int id)
{
int i, idx = 0;
@@ -29,3 +30,4 @@ out:
*valp = regs->cache_regs[id];
return 0;
}
+#endif
diff --git a/tools/perf/util/perf_regs.h b/tools/perf/util/perf_regs.h
index 2984dcc..679d6e4 100644
--- a/tools/perf/util/perf_regs.h
+++ b/tools/perf/util/perf_regs.h
@@ -2,6 +2,7 @@
#define __PERF_REGS_H
#include <linux/types.h>
+#include <linux/compiler.h>
struct regs_dump;
